CRUDE OIL WEEKLY ANALYSIS
CRUDE OIL closed on Friday at its weekly support levels after tested the high level of $ 70.54 in the same weekly trading session as WTI crude oil futures declined 2.4% to settle at $67 per barrel on Friday, booking a weekly loss of 5%, pressure by concerns over China’s waning demand and stronger US dollar. China’s crude processing dropped 4.6% in October, reflecting slower factory output and persistent demand issues.
